Output 90f27db3005ed6ca75068f16df7861db094c03cc200bf71a77cae7bc7edee2a0:2

value
130525210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de5b1a36b259ecb63fa4ba05ed020b8b6e74a3b0 OP_EQUAL
address
3Mxj5327DFt28AnusPLD5hESgo8VzF6HtG
transaction
90f27db3005ed6ca75068f16df7861db094c03cc200bf71a77cae7bc7edee2a0
spent
true